On Monday the 9thJuly we welcomed the Lady Captain of Hampshire, Sue Oldershaw and her team of ladies to Copthorne Golf club for this years match. Sue lives and plays her golf on the Isle of Wight which involves catching a ferry every time she plays golf on the mainland.

Copthorne, was founded in 1892 and in the 1930’s the course was redesigned by  James Braid, with many other changes having been made over the years including a new extension to the club house which has just been completed. The course is heathland come woodland with tree lined fairways and ditches guarding the greens.

Rosie Chisholm-Hill, Copthorne Lady Captain, kindly started everyone on their way. The course was in excellent condition albeit looking a little dry, allowing the ball to run a few extra yards!!

Again we were blessed with yet another beautiful hot sunny day, with a welcome light breeze to cool us down. A good days golf was had by all with an excellent meal to finish.

Thanks were given to the catering and bar staff for looking after us so well and to all the ladies for taking part. Sue then gave out the result of this friendly competitive match of 5 – 3 in favour of Sussex.
